Weather in January

January, the same as December, is another warm winter month in Middle Quarters, Jamaica, with an average temperature ranging between min 18.8°C (65.8°F) and max 27°C (80.6°F).

Temperature

January is the coldest month of the year, registering average temperatures as high as 27°C (80.6°F) and as low as 18.8°C (65.8°F).

Heat index

January's heat index is calculated to be a hot 30°C (86°F). If one continues to be active during enduring exposure, it could result in fatigue and heat cramps.
Know that the heat index computations account for shaded terrains and slight winds. Direct sunlight might lead to a heat index increase by up to 15 Fahrenheit (8 Celsius) degrees.
Note: The heat index, also known as 'apparent temperature' or 'real feel', integrates the air's temperature and its humidity to showcase the felt temperature by people. The influence of weather is personal, with varied individuals experiencing it differently due to differences in body mass, stature, and physical exertion levels. Keep aware, the sun, when shining directly, can intensify the heat experience, pushing the heat index up by 15 Fahrenheit (8 Celsius) degrees. Heat index values are particularly important for children. Kids are usually in more danger than grown-ups as they tend to sweat less. Plus, their bigger skin surface in relation to their small frames and increased heat generation due to their activity level make them more susceptible.

Humidity

In January, the average relative humidity in Middle Quarters is 83%.

Rainfall

January is the month with the least rainfall in Middle Quarters, Jamaica. Rain falls for 22.1 days and accumulates 56mm (2.2") of precipitation.

Daylight

In Middle Quarters, the average length of the day in January is 11h and 11min.
On the first day of January, sunrise is at 06:42 and sunset at 17:46. On the last day of the month, sunrise is at 06:44 and sunset at 18:05 EST.

Sunshine

The average sunshine in January is 6.8h.

UV index

In Middle Quarters, the average daily maximum UV index in January is 6. A UV Index value of 6 to 7 symbolizes a high health risk from exposure to the Sun's UV radiation for ordinary individuals.
Note: During January, 6 as the daily maximum UV index converts into the following advice:
Enforce precautions and stick to sun safety measures. Preservation from skin and eye damage is essential. The hours from 10 a.m. to 4 p.m. have the most intense UV radiation. As much as possible, limit direct sun exposure during this period. Outfit yourself in sun-safe attire, like long sleeves, pants, a hat, and UV-blocking sunglasses.
